Chimichanga De Vegetables Recipe

Inspired by Rj Mexican Cuisine
Time30m
Serves4

zucchini, squash, bell peppers, spanish onions, avocado, salsa verde, queso fresco

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Vegetables

    Chop the zucchini, squash, bell peppers, and Spanish onions into small pieces.

  2. 2

    Sauté the Vegetables

    In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ped vegetables and sauté until they are tender, about 5-7 minutes.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

  3. 3

    Assemble the Chimichangas

    On each flour tortilla, layer a portion of the sautéed vegetables, a few slices of avocado, and a sprinkle of queso fresco. Drizzle with salsa verde.

  4. 4

    Wrap the Chimichangas

    Fold the sides of the tortilla over the filling, then roll it up tightly from the bottom to seal.

  5. 5

    Fry the Chimichangas

    In the same skillet, add more olive oil if needed and heat over medium-high heat. Place the chimichangas seam side down in the skillet and fry until golden brown and crispy, about 3-4 minutes per side.

  6. 6

    Serve

    Remove the chimichangas from the skillet and let them drain on paper towels. Serve hot with extra salsa verde and queso fresco on the side.
